An unlicensed drink driver has had his ute seized after trying to flee from police who caught him mid-burnout in Gordon on Friday.

Police tried to stop the dark coloured Holden Commodore utility after the driver was seen performing a burnout at the roundabout intersection of Woodcock Drive and Knoke Avenue around 1.30am.
The 20-year-old driver, from Gordon, instead accelerated away on Woodcock Drive and stopped in a driveway after about 30 seconds. Both the driver and passenger fled on foot, but were taken into custody.
The driver was taken to Tuggeranong Police Station, where he underwent breath analysis and returned a Blood Alcohol Concentration of 0.092.
The driver, whose license had expired, was issued with an Immediate Suspension Notice and had his vehicle seized by police.
The man will face court, with a date yet to be set, while the passenger released a short time after being taken into custody.
